In a captivating continuation of the legendary tale of survival, readers are reintroduced to Robinson Crusoe, an adventurous soul whose remarkable journey does not end with his initial escapades on a deserted island. The sequel chronicles Crusoe's ongoing quest for exploration and self-discovery, revealing the complexities of human resilience and the insatiable thirst for adventure that drives him.
As Crusoe returns to civilization, he grapples with the challenges of reintegration into society, often reflecting on his years spent in isolation. Engaging with new cultures and encountering shipwrecks, pirates, and other perils, he faces both the excitement and dangers that the outside world presents, reminding readers of the unpredictability of life and the lessons it teaches along the way.
Amidst thrilling encounters and a deepening understanding of his identity, Crusoe's story evolves into a rich tapestry of action and introspection. The narrative reminds us that the quest for meaning does not cease with physical survival but continues as one navigates the ever-changing course of life.
